Global Market Overview

The global fire retardant clothing market is projected to witness significant growth in the coming years. Factors contributing to this growth include:

  • Regulations and Compliance: Stringent workplace safety regulations are prompting industries to invest in high-quality fire-resistant Uniforms.
  • Technological Advancements: Innovations in fabric technology are leading to the development of lighter and more breathable materials.
  • Rising Awareness: Increased awareness of occupational hazards is compelling companies to upgrade their employee safety gear.

Current Export Trends

Several trends are shaping the export market for fire retardant clothing:

  • North America Dominance: The North American market holds a significant share due to the presence of large-end user industries and regulatory frameworks that demand the use of fire retardant clothing.
  • Growing Asia-Pacific Market: Countries in the Asia-Pacific region are anticipated to register the highest growth rate; this is fueled by increasing industrialization and safety standards in developing economies.
  • Custom Solutions: An emerging trend is the demand for customized fire retardant clothing that caters to specific job roles and hazards.

Market Insights and Consumer Preferences

Consumers are increasingly opting for fire retardant clothing that combines safety with style. The shift in market dynamics shows that businesses are not solely focused on compliance but also recognize the importance of delivering fashionable and comfortable workwear.

Some key insights include:

  • Comfort over Compliance: Employees prefer clothing that feels good while still offering necessary protection.
  • Eco-friendly Options: Manufacturers are responding to consumer demand for sustainable and eco-friendly material alternatives.
  • Versatility: Fire retardant clothing that can perform in various conditions – from industrial environments to outdoor settings – is gaining traction.

Challenges Facing the Industry

While the outlook for fire retardant clothing is positive, several challenges remain:

  • Cost of Production: High-quality materials often lead to higher manufacturing costs, impacting small and medium enterprises.
  • Counterfeit Products: The market is plagued by counterfeit products that compromise safety standards.
  • Knowledge Gaps: Limited awareness among businesses regarding available technologies has slowed the overall market evolution.

1. What is fire retardant clothing?

Fire retardant clothing is specially designed to resist igniting and burning, providing protection against flames. These garments are used primarily in industries like manufacturing, oil, and gas.

2. Why is certification important for fire retardant clothing?

Certifications like BSCI, SEDEX, and OEKO-TEX® ensure that fire retardant clothing meets industry safety standards, is ethically produced, and is free from harmful substances, thereby protecting both the wearer and the environment.

3. How do I choose the right fire retardant clothing?

Select fire retardant clothing based on the specific hazards of your work environment, the required level of protection, comfort, and breathability. Consulting a safety expert can also provide valuable insights.

4. What industries require fire retardant clothing?

Industries that often require fire retardant clothing include construction, oil and gas, manufacturing, electrical work, and firefighting.
